Daniel Craig will not bow out as Bond with Sam Mendes‘ Skyfall, Deadline reports. Craig will return for two further adventures at least, seeing him play 007 in the 24th and 25th instalments of the ongoing saga. This will make him the third-longest serving Bond actor in the franchise’s history. Sony Pictures and MGM will continue to […]

After more than 20 feature film adaptations of his creation James Bond, author Ian Fleming is set to be the subject of an upcoming biopic. According to Deadline, Moon and Source Code helmer Duncan Jones is set to direct a movie based on Andrew Lycett’s biography of the late writer. Matthew Brown has penned the script. Production on the next instalment of the James Bond franchise has been put on indefinite hold due to the uncertain financial situation of distributor Metro-Goldwyn-Mayer, according to Business Week. The future of the Bond series (and indeed, the future of MGM) has been in doubt for much of the past 12 months. Michael G. Wilson […]
